Our co-mediation model provides:

  • Greater neutrality
    Two mediators create a more balanced space where each person feels heard, respected, and supported.

  • Enhanced communication
    A collaborative team helps guide complex conversations with clarity and care, reducing tension and misunderstandings.

  • Trauma-informed practice
    Co-mediation allows us to respond more sensitively to emotional triggers, power imbalances, and the unique needs of each participant.

  • Broader expertise
    With complementary skills and experience, we offer creative, well-rounded solutions tailored to each family.

  • Structure and clarity
    Two professionals working in tandem help keep discussions focused, productive, and on track.

  • Emotional safety
    Clients benefit from a calm, empathetic environment that supports both practical outcomes and emotional wellbeing.
